Pottery as a Therapeutic ADHD Outlet

Pottery checks many of the boxes that ADHD adults seek in therapy-like environments: it’s quiet, grounding, nonverbal, and sensory-rich. According to CHADD, adults with ADHD benefit from hands-on, goal-oriented activities that provide structure without strict control.
